Dogma is an all-female melodic metal quintet originally formed of members from multiple regions of South America - Lilith (vocals), Lamia (guitar), Nixe (bass), Abrahel (drums). They are signed with MNRK Heavy. The group has gone through multiple lineup changes whilst still retaining the same band member monikers - Lilith, Nixe, Lamia, Abrahel, respectively. In 2024 the band introduced newest member and second guitarist Rusalka. It is not yet known where Dogma is primarily based out of.

    Manchester has become one of the largest cities in Britain over the past hundred years. Although Manchester is a city with a very rich history, the main focus of its development has always been industry. The center is almost entirely furnished with warehouses and factory buildings, entangled with a network of canals and old railway bridges. It is quite natural that no one gave such kindness to the reduction of production: in the former shops now open fashionable bars, in factory warehouses - designer shops, and under the old bridges "settled" nightclubs. It was for the active nightlife of the city and got its middle name - Madchester.
